Instructions to Download Images with OpenImage Utility
- Initially, launch the application and navigate to Task>> New Download.
- Here, you just enter the URL of selected website from where you want to download images.
- Select the output location folder to store downloaded files.
- You can customize the settings such as change the file size, file format and rename the files.
- Finally, hit the Create button to instigate the downloading process.
OpenImage 2.0.0.1 utility is compatible with Windows XP/Vista /7. It is a standalone application, so the users just need to run the executable file to launch the application i.e. no need to install the application. The only thing that users need to have is .NET Framework 2.0 or above version on system to run it properly. If you find it useful then download it from here on your computer.
